    May I ask, what makes you keen on regging LLLL.net domains?

    When will they start increasing? When the domain forums have hyped them up enough & they all have been bought out. In the end of the day, the value of LLLL.net domains will depend on that the LLLL are, eg. Porn.net is worth a lot more than ZQPX.net

    Only quad and triple premiums are going above reg fee right now (reseller market). Everything else (there are exeptions) is worth reg fee.
